登录
|
注册
返回首页
联系我们
在线留言
满分5
>
高中数学试题
>
试设计求两个正整数m,n的最大公约数的程序.
试设计求两个正整数m,n的最大公约数的程序.
输入m和n两个数字,求两个数字相除的余数,当余数不为0时,把n赋给m,把r赋给n,再求两个数字的余数,当余数不为0时,继续循环,直到型的是直到满足条件结束循环.从而同程序即可. 【解析】 用辗转相除法设计程序如下: Input“m=”;m Input“n=”;n If m MOD n=n then n=x end if r=m MOD n while r<>0 r=m MOD n m=n n=r wend print m end
复制答案
考点分析:
相关试题推荐
用秦九韶算法求多项式f(x)=7x
7
+6x
6
+5x
5
+4x
4
+3x
3
+2x
2
+x当x=3时的值.
查看答案
用更相减损术求612与468的最大公约数.
查看答案
用辗转相除法求840与1785的最大公约数:
查看答案
完成下列进位制之间的转化.1011001
(2)
=
(10)=
(5)
105
(8)
=
(10)=
(5)
312
(5)
=
(7)20212
(3)
=
(10)
查看答案
若六进数13m502
(6)
化为十进数为12710,则m=
,把12710化为八进数为
.
查看答案
试题属性
题型:解答题
难度:中等
Copyright @ 2008-2019 满分5 学习网 ManFen5.COM. All Rights Reserved.